Ukrainian Defense Official Confident in Counter-Offensive Despite Russian Missile Attacks

TL;DR Summary
Ukraine's plans for a counteroffensive against Russian occupation remain on track, despite an "unprecedented" wave of missile and drone attacks across the country in recent weeks. Ukraine had faced repeated volleys of ballistic missiles in May, especially in urban centres including the capital, Kyiv. Ukraine's air defense systems had been "more than 90 percent effective" against the attacks. Ukraine expects NATO allies to provide a detailed roadmap to membership at the defense pact's summit in Vilnius, Lithuania, next month.
